      LonDOn JunioR Chess Championship

      Qualification Criteria

       The London Junior Chess Championships originated in 1924 as the London Boys Championship. More information: HERE

        Scores required in Qualifying Events

      U8 - 4 points or more out of 6 

      U10 Major - 4.5 points or more out of 6  

      U10 Minor - 3.5 points or 4 points out of 6  

      U12 Major - 4.5 points or more out of 6  

      U12 Minor - 3.5 points or 4 points out of 6

           The London Junior Chess Championships originated in 1924 as the London Boys Championship. The championships are organised by The London Junior Chess Championship Charitable Trust, registered charity number 1129010. Titles are awarded for seven age groups, Under 8, Under 10, Under 12, Under 14, Under 16, Under 18 and Under 21. To play in the Under 8, Under 10 or Under 12 Finals you must first qualify, either via a qualifying tournament or by r. Qualification is not required for the older age groups.
